#72ebd0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#72ebd0 is composed of 44.7% red, 92.2%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.5%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 166.6 degrees, a saturation of 75.2% and a lightness of 68.4%. #72ebd0 color hex could be obtained by blending #e4ffff with #00d7a1.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#72ebd0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020e0b is the darkest color, while #fbf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#72ebd0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aab3b1 is the less saturated color, while #5ffeda is the most saturated one.
